RM: "If someone visiting Seoul for the first time asks you to plan a trip for them, where would you recommend?" Suga: "If I had foreign friends coming to visit, I would recommend Jongno, along with Gyeongbokgung Palace. Especially these days, a lot of younger crowds visit the area and there are a bunch of hot spots nearby."
